WebYour routing number is a unique 9 digit code which shows the bank branch where you opened your account. Along with your account number, your routing number is used to guide payments and identify your account when you're writing a check, wiring money, or paying a bill. A SWIFT/BIC is an 8-11 character code that identifies your country, city, bank, and branch. Bank code A-Z 4 letters representing the bank. It usually looks like a shortened version of that bank's name.
